Betamaxed

What is Betamaxed?


1.

When a technology is overtaken in the market by inferior but better marketed competition.

“Microsoft betamaxed Apple right out of the market”

See Mudit


6

Random Words:

1. The frustrating experience of pedestrian traffic being slowed to a crawl by the elderly. Most commonly used in supermarket aisles, narro..
1. the inability to believe how old you have become. "The day he turned 75, George was diagnosed with incredimentia." See den..
1. A site that revolves around the popular Nickelodeon show Avatar: The Last Airbender which includes a gallery, forum, and a live chat. Th..